Java视角解构PHP:OOP建站精要
|
作为无代码站长,我经常看到很多开发者在选择建站语言时陷入纠结,尤其是Java和PHP之间的选择。其实从OOP(面向对象编程)的角度来看,两者都有其独特的优势。
AI绘图,仅供参考 PHP虽然起步简单,但它的OOP特性在近年来得到了极大的提升,比如引入了命名空间、接口、抽象类等现代编程概念,让PHP也能构建出结构清晰、可维护性强的网站。Java的OOP理念更为严谨,它强制要求开发者遵循封装、继承、多态等原则,这在大型项目中能有效降低耦合度,提高代码复用率。对于需要长期维护的站点来说,这种结构上的优势尤为明显。 不过,PHP的灵活性和快速开发能力仍然是它的强项,尤其是在无代码或低代码平台中,PHP的生态更贴近内容管理系统的实际需求,比如WordPress就是基于PHP构建的。 Java虽然在Web开发上不如PHP那么直接,但它的后端能力更强,适合需要高性能、高并发的站点。如果站长希望未来扩展到企业级应用,Java可能是更好的选择。 无论是PHP还是Java,OOP的核心思想都是为了提升代码的可读性、可维护性和可扩展性。对于站长来说,理解这些思想比单纯依赖某个语言更重要。 最终,选择哪种语言取决于项目需求和个人技术栈。但只要掌握了OOP的本质,无论使用什么工具,都能打造出高效、稳定的网站。 (编辑:草根网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330554号